Isabella House is a circa 1885 cottage with vintage character and charm located on Canal Street in downtown Natchez, Mississippi. Within short walking distance are such attractions as: The Natchez Visitor Center, Bluff Park and walking trail, The Convention Center, historic Under-The-Hill Saloon as well as beautiful antebellum homes and the mighty Mississippi River himself. The cottage has been lovingly renovated from a state of total disrepair and is available for nightly and weekly stays comfortably accommodating 2-4 guests. Although furnished with many unique and antique pieces, it still offers modern conveniences such as TV, internet, dishwasher and washer/dryer as well as complimentary beverages. The rear courtyard is spacious and private and has a grill and chiminea for guest use. At Isabella House, you'll be within walking distance of wonderful downtown shops, restaurants and entertainment, but you might not want to leave the back porch!
